Imphal, May 24 2015 :
The 29th of May, 1944 saw the end of a battle between Japanese army and Allied force, a fierce battle fought during the second world war era which has come to be known as the battle of Red Hill or Lotpaching.
To commemorate the 71st anniversary of the battle, Australian High Commissioner to India, Patrick Suckling and Ambassador of Japan to India, Takeshi Yagi will pay homage at Maibam Lotpa Ching, Nambol on
May 29 .
The 71st commemoration event is being organised jointly by Manipur Tourism Forum and 2nd World War Imphal Campaign.
